Matrix knows that your vehicle – not to mention its precious cargo – is extremely important to you. They offer a range of tailor-made packages designed to combat the realities of car theft and hijacking in South Africa, with tiers customised to suit your individual safety, security and personal vehicle-tracking needs.

Why some of our users choose Matrix:
- Matrix’s advanced GPS technology allows them to pinpoint your stolen or hijacked vehicle’s location anywhere in South Africa in less than 30 seconds.
- Matrix can track your vehicle whether it’s on the road, out in the open, underground or even in a concealed shipping container. Think superhero X-ray vision, made real.
- If you have specific concerns about your or your vehicle’s safety, you can level up to the MX2 or MX3 devices. These come with additional tiered benefits, such as panic buttons, a smartphone app, roadside assistance, crash alerts and border alerts.
- Certain areas in South Africa are known hotspots for crime. Matrix calls these No-Go Zones. Should your MX3-enabled vehicle enter one, you’ll receive a notification immediately. Your location will also be sent to the control room, where a Matrix agent will contact you to find out if you are in any danger or require assistance.
- With Matrix’s electronic SARS tax logbook, you can easily and effortlessly track, measure and monitor vehicle mileage, fuel consumption and maintenance costs.

Did you know?
- Matrix falls under the umbrella of MIX Telematics, a global leader in fleet and mobile asset management solutions. MIX Telematics is currently operational in more than 120 countries.
- Matrix was the 2021/22 winner in the Car Tracking Industry category at the Ask Afrika Orange Index Awards.
- If you’re not the most tech-savvy person and you’re struggling to use the Matrix smartphone app, head to their YouTube channel, where you’ll find handy tutorial videos.
